An additional technique for the MAC is available in v2.02. Access
your bookmarks file by clicking on Bookmarks in the Window menu. When
the list comes up, Click on the File menu and choose: What's New?
This will activate a program that will check whether or not your
bookmarked links are active or have changed.

Unfortunately, Win v2.02 does not have this feature. What's new is in
the Netscape area and connects you to the Netscape home page. If
anyone has v3, you might see if the MAC feature has been added.
